DATA DIODES MARKET OVERVIEW
The global Data Diodes Market is valued at USD 0.57 Billion in 2026 and is projected to reach USD 2.31 Billion by 2035. It grows at a compound annual growth rate (CAGR) of around 16.84% from 2026 to 2035.

- DIN Rail : DIN Rail systems hold approximately 39% market share, with over 68% adoption in industrial automation environments. Around 64% of manufacturing units rely on DIN rail-mounted data diodes for secure communication between PLCs and SCADA systems. Approximately 61% of installations are in compact industrial setups where space optimization is critical. Top 2 Companies with Highest Market Share:
- Waterfall Security Solutions holds approximately 18% market share with over 1,500 installations globally
- Owl & Tresys accounts for nearly 16% market share with deployments across 30+ countries
